Early Life and the Formation of Team 7
A Timid Start
Sakura began her journey as an intelligent but insecure young ninja, often teased for her broad forehead. She admired Sasuke Uchiha and found Naruto annoying—a classic schoolgirl dynamic. Despite being academically sharp, she lacked real combat skills.
Meeting Naruto and Sasuke
Her placement in Team 7 alongside Naruto Uzumaki and Sasuke Uchiha, under the leadership of Kakashi Hatake, would forever change her destiny. This trio was unbalanced in power at first—Naruto with sheer willpower, Sasuke with natural talent, and Sakura with…book smarts.

Training Under Tsunade – The Path to Power
Becoming a Medical Ninja
Under the training of Tsunade, the Fifth Hokage and one of the Sannin, Sakura began rigorous training in medical ninjutsu. She also inherited Tsunade’s monstrous strength and precision, transforming into a combatant feared even by elite shinobi.
Chakra Control and Combat Skill
Her perfect chakra control enabled her to deliver devastating punches and heal the gravest of injuries. In Shippuden, she becomes one of the key players during the Fourth Great Ninja War, proving her worth on and off the battlefield.
Major Battles and Contributions
Facing Sasori of the Akatsuki
Sakura’s battle alongside Chiyo against Sasori marked a pivotal moment in her growth. This was her first major victory against a top-tier enemy, showcasing her strategic mind, courage, and raw strength.
Fourth Shinobi War
In the Fourth Great Ninja War, Sakura played a crucial role as part of the medical corps and later fought alongside Naruto and Sasuke against Kaguya Otsutsuki. Her punch helped land the final blow needed to seal the threat to the ninja world.

Rekindling Her Bond with Sasuke
Even after everything, Sakura continued to love Sasuke. After the war, Sasuke acknowledged her love, and they eventually married, having a daughter named Sarada Uchiha. Their story is a tale of redemption, forgiveness, and emotional complexity.
Legacy in Boruto
In the Boruto era, Sakura is a senior medical ninja, head of Konoha’s medical department, and a loving mother. She continues to inspire a new generation of ninja, including her daughter Sarada.
